"Darkwood" (2017), developed by the innovative duo Crunching Koalas and Acid Wizard, is a top-down survival horror game that plunges players into the heart of a nightmarish, procedurally generated forest. Set in a hauntingly beautiful yet terrifying world, the game masterfully blends elements of psychological horror with survival mechanics, challenging players to manage resources, craft tools, and fend off grotesque creatures that lurk in the shadows. The unique day-night cycle adds a layer of tension, as players must prepare and fortify their hideouts before nightfall, when the forest becomes a deadly labyrinth of horrors.
What sets "Darkwood" apart is its atmospheric storytelling and immersive sound design, which together create an unsettling experience that lingers long after the game is over. The narrative unfolds through environmental clues and cryptic interactions with the few surviving inhabitants of the forest, drawing players deeper into a mystery that is as compelling as it is disturbing. The game's pixel art style, while seemingly simplistic, effectively conveys the eerie beauty and terror of the forest, making every shadow and rustle a potential threat.
Gameplay in "Darkwood" is a delicate balance of exploration and survival, with players needing to scavenge for resources during the day while avoiding or confronting the dangers that emerge at night. The crafting system is intuitive yet challenging, requiring players to make strategic decisions about what to create and when, adding depth to the survival experience. The ever-present threat of the unknown keeps players on edge, as the forest's dangers are unpredictable and often deadly.
